Outside of a one-off new track that appeared on Ben Folds' 2011 Best Imitation of Myself: A Retrospective compilation, it's been an awfully long time since the Ben Folds Five have graced listeners with a full-on dose of their signature blend of winsome nostalgia and collegiate snark. Funded through the direct-to-fan/fan-funded music platform PledgeMusic, with a portion of the funds delegated to a music education and music therapy charity chosen by the trio, the ten-track The Sound of the Life of the Mind represents the Ben Folds Five's fourth studio album and first set of new music in 13 years.
